Mission

 

The Market access director EMEA is responsible for executing, adapting, and operationalizing the global market access & reimbursement strategy across EMEA healthcare systems. The role owns regional access outcomes, including payer, HTA & physician engagement, translating global strategy into country-level coverage, reimbursement, patient referral enablement, and stakeholder alignment.

Challenges we trust you with

 

1. Strategy execution & regional ownership
•     Execute global market access & reimbursement strategy across EMEA markets.
•     Propose regional indication & country prioritization based on feasibility, readiness, & impact.
•     Own end-to-end regional execution, from strategy deployment to measurable outcomes.
•     Act as the regional decision-maker within the global strategic framework.


2. Coverage & reimbursement (EMEA)
•     Implement and optimize coverage pathways across diverse EMEA payer systems.
•     Lead country-level reimbursement strategy, including inpatient/outpatient pathways.
•     Manage payer negotiations, coverage policies, and reimbursement optimization.
•     Monitor and respond to local access barriers and policy changes.


3. Coding & Financing
•     Execute coding strategies (e.g. DRG, procedure codes, bundled payments) at country level.
•     Map and operationalize country-specific financial flows and hospital economics.
•     Identify and resolve structural or operational coding and funding gaps.
•     Support hospitals with practical deployment of access solutions.


4. Evidence, HEOR & value deployment
•     Localize and deploy the value proposition and global value dossier.
•     Identify local evidence and HEOR needs aligned with payer expectations.
•     Support country-specific RWE generation and evidence implementation.
•     Ensure value messages are operational, credible, and payer-relevant.


5. Payer, HTA, public affairs & physician / referral engagement
•     Lead operational payer and HTA engagement at country and regional level.
•     Execute public affairs actions in alignment with global strategy.
•     Lead physician and KOL engagement and actively structure, educate, and operationalize patient referral pathways for proton therapy, in alignment with payers, centers, and coverage requirements.


6. Regional enablement & governance
•      Reports to the global market access lead, with dotted line to regional lead 
•     Manage regional consultants and external partners.
•     Own regional budget execution and resource allocation.
